Another captivating aspect of Burslem is its rich literary connection. It was the birthplace and home of the celebrated novelist and social commentator, Arnold Bennett. Best known for his 'Five Towns' novels, Bennett immortalised Burslem as the town of 'Bursley'. His affectionate and vivid depiction of the town and its people in the early 20th century has provided a lasting literary legacy. Burslem ( BURZ-lm) is one of the six towns that along with Hanley, Tunstall, Fenton, Longton and Stoke-upon-Trent form part of the city of Stoke-on-Trent in Staffordshire, England. It is often referred to as the "mother town" of Stoke on Trent.
